Temperature Comparison in November

Los Angeles reaches an average high of 23°C (73°F) and drops to 10°C (50°F) at night during November. The daily temperature range is 13°C, meaning significant temperature swings between day and night.

Miami averages 26°C (79°F) for the high and 22°C (72°F) for the low, with a daily range of 4°C. The 3°C difference is noticeable but not dramatic.

Both cities are in the Northern Hemisphere, so they share the same seasonal pattern in November.

Rainfall Comparison in November

Los Angeles receives approximately 20 mm of rainfall across 2 rain days during November. Rain is rare this month, so dry conditions are likely.

Miami sees 55 mm over 9 rain days. That makes Los Angeles the drier option by 7 rain days and 35 mm of total precipitation.

Both cities share similar humidity levels at 70%.

Year-Round Comparison: Los Angeles vs Miami

The table below shows average high temperatures and rain days for every month of the year, helping you find the best time to visit either city.November is highlighted for quick reference.

MonthLos AngelesMiami
HighRainHighRain
Jan19°C5d23°C8d
Feb20°C6d24°C7d
Mar21°C5d25°C7d
Apr24°C3d27°C8d
May25°C2d28°C12d
Jun28°C0d29°C20d
Jul31°C0d30°C21d
Aug32°C0d30°C22d
Sep31°C1d29°C22d
Oct28°C2d28°C15d
Nov23°C2d26°C9d
Dec19°C5d24°C8d

Climate data sourced from the Open-Meteo Historical Weather API, using ERA5 reanalysis data covering 30-year normals from 1991 to 2020. All temperatures shown in Celsius with Fahrenheit equivalents. Rain days count days with 1 mm or more of precipitation. Sunshine hours represent average daily values. This comparison is generated from long-term climate averages and individual trips may vary.
